Rhana of No Entry Passes away


Mannin mainthar (Son of Soil) Rhana, a member of the famous Malaysian Tamil band No Entry , has passed away yesterday. Puchong Based Rhana’s death has caused many fans to be very surprised and upset. One of his hit songs include Antera Manal Medu. Rhana is also the vice president of ANTERA Motorsports.


It was reported that Rhana, or his real name Thanasegaran Kaniappan, 34,  and other two victims  were killed after the Mitsubishi Triton four-wheel drive they were in crashed into a tree along Kilometre 24 of the Pasir Gudang Highway here early in the  morning.The victim’s remains were sent to the Sultan Ismail Hospital.Seri Alam police chief Superintendent Roslan Zainuddin said it is believed that the vehicle that the victims, who were from Selangor and Kuala Lumpur, were travelling in had lost control and skidded off course before crashing into a tree that divided the highway.
All the occupants of the vehicle were killed instantly due to serious injuries suffered from the accident,” he said when contacted today. Roslan said investigations showed that the accident location had ample street lighting, while the roads were in good condition and it was not raining.
“The cause of the crash was believed to be due to the driver losing control of his vehicle,” he said, adding that no other vehicles were involved in the accident. Police have classified the case under Section 41(1) of the Road Transport Act 1987.

Arrambam


Arrambam is the soundtrack album, composed by Yuvan Shankar Raja, to the 2013action thriller film of the same name, directed by Vishnuvardhan starring Ajith KumarArya,Nayantara and Taapsee Pannu. The album consists of five tracks. Pa. Vijay penned all lyrics for the songs.[1] It was released on September 19, 2013.[2] The album opened at number one on iTunes India within a few minutes after its release at midnight,[3][4] which, according to Sify, "no Tamil album has done before".[5]



Production

Yuvan Shankar Raja was signed on to compose the film's soundtrack and score, becoming his sixth project starring Ajith Kumar. In November 2012, Yuvan Shankar Raja composed a new song for the film.[6] On 23 April 2013 the composer tweeted that he had completed three songs,[7] and that one of which was a "mass intro song" rendered by Shankar Mahadevan.[8][9] Vijay Yesudas stated that he had sung a "celebration song" in the film.[10]
In August 2013 it was reported that Vairamuthu's younger son Kabilan Vairamuthu was roped in to pen lyrics for a song in the film, the first time working with Yuvan.[11] His lyrics were scrapped later and all five songs were written by Pa. Vijay only.
The music rights were bagged by Sony Music India.[12]

Release

Yuvan Shankar Raja had handed over the master copy of the audio to the film's producer on 21 August and it was reported that the soundtrack would release on September 9 for Vinayagar Chaturthi.[13] On September 14, 2013, Sony Music India announced that the album would be released directly to stores on September 19, while also revealing the tracklist.
On the same day, Theatrical trailer was released and went viral in YouTube. The trailer received massive response all over India as "Most Stylish one ever" leaving the high expectations in the kollywood.This movie was scheduled to release on 31st October 2013 two days before Diwali. [14]

Reception


Behindwoods.com rated the album 3.75 out of 5 and stated "Pulsating rhythms, entertaining hooks and hair-raising lyrical moments make Arrambam a commercial heavyweight".[15] Indiaglitz.com rated the album 3.5/5 and stated "Yuvan strikes a Homerun".[16]
The album has also been a commercial success and described as "one of the biggest hits of the year".[17] Upon its release on September 19, at midnight, the album immediately reached number one spot on the iTunes India store.[3][18] Sify wrote that "no Tamil album has done (this feat) before".[5] Ashok Parwani, General Manager at Sony Music, stated that it had done "very well from a sales perspective".[17] The CDs were sold out within two days and the second batch of hit the stores on 23 September.[19]
